5 Simple Stages to Prevent Water Damage from a Burst Water Pipe
What should you do if a water pipeline ruptureds in your residence, creating a mini-waterfall as well as swamping a location of your residence? The longer you wait, the more severe the water damage in your building. For these factors, you require to discover what to in instance of a ruptured water pipeline.

Shut Off the Main Waterline Valve



The first thing you have to do is shut the shut-off shutoff. Try to find the neighborhood shut-off shutoff to turn-off water in one details location just. If you do not recognize where the local shut-off shutoff to the component is, you need to turn-off the primary waterline shutoff. This will certainly remove the water in your whole home. Usually, the major valve is found outside the residence alongside the water meter. You can additionally discover it in the cellar at an eye-level or it could be in the 1st floor on the ground if it's not there. Normally, building contractors yet the shut-off valve in the main ground degree washroom or appropriate beside it.

Record the Damages For Insurance policy



As you are waiting for the pros to arrive, record the damages brought on by the wayward pipe. Take photos as well as videos of whatever. Do closeup shots of prized possessions. These points will certainly serve as evidence for your house owner's insurance policy. Remaining aggressive with this allows you to file a claim for coverage, which will certainly aid you and your family return on your feet.

Restore Points That Can Be Saved



When you're done taking pictures, browse the things and secure one of the most essential ones from the stack. Dry them off and try to preserve as long as you can. Drag them away from wetness so they can begin to dry out.

Begin the Drying Process



Luckily, water from your waterlines are tidy so you don't have to stress about sewage system water. The flowing water may have interrupted the dust as well as particles in your floorboards and also carpetings. Be prepared with gloves as you utilize containers to unload out the water.

Professionals are the only ones qualified to take care of the burs pipelines and also succeeding damages. And remember, pipelines don't simply instantly burst. You will normally see red flags like gurgling paint, weird noises in the plumbing, mildewy smell, caving ceiling, peeling off wallpaper, or water stains. Focus on these things, so you can nip any issues in the bud.
